The problem with the sith always was their lust for power. The Sith always betrayed themself in the worst possible moments

-Darth Malak betrayed Revan in the moment he was about to beat Bastila
-Valkorion betrayed all Sith to gain immortality,but nearly eradicated the Sith by doing so
-Malgus betrayed the Sith Empire to create his own Empire but weakend the Sith Empire

There are to many examples of the Sith betraying themself and nearly killing their bratheren. Palpatines reign was the most stable time for the Sith and almost whiped out the Jedi.
